3Emiliano Martinez 4

Emi Martinez, when will his time come?

It might seem rough to give someone who isn’t playing a ‘4’ but that’s exactly why he’s getting it.

Emi Martinez must surely be approaching a crunch decision. He’s 26 now, an age by which some of his peers had already established themselves as their respective clubs’ number one.

Martinez has not even come close to doing that.

There’s no doubting that Martinez has looked decent when he’s been given a chance, but that’s all he’s really been – decent. That’s good enough for a club lower down the football pyramid, but it will never get him the number one shirt at Arsenal, at least not while someone like Leno is at the club.

That he can’t even push past Petr Cech who is well into the twilight of his career speaks volumes but the previous regime placed a lot of faith in him, awarding him a contract until 2022.

So far this season, he has one Premier League 2 appearance to his name. He is the same age as Leno who has 314 senior appearances to his name with Bayer Leverkusen and Arsenal.

Martinez has 19 with Arsenal and Getafe plus 39 with Wolves, Sheffield Wednesday, Rotherham United and Oxford United.
